Blacklight: Tango Down

Zombie Studios’ New First Person Shooter to Deliver Intense Multiplayer,
AAA Game Quality through Downloadable Channels on Xbox 360®, PlayStation®3 and PC

GLENDALE, CA – March 2nd 2010 – Ignition Entertainment, a UTV Media Communication Company, and Zombie Studios are developing Blacklight: Tango Down, a near-future first person shooter that will offer AAA-quality military shooter action in a downloadable package.  Blacklight: Tango Down will be available Summer 2010 through Xbox LIVE® Arcade for the Xbox 360® video game and entertainment system from Microsoft, PlayStation®Network for PlayStation®3 computer entertainment system, and for personal computer.

Metro 2033 release date confirmed

AGOURA HILLS, Calif. January 28th, 2010 — THQ Inc. today announced that Metro 2033TM, the hotly anticipated first person shooter for Xbox 360® and PC, is scheduled to reach North American stores on March 16th, and European stores on March 19th 2010.  

 A Limited Edition will be available for both formats, including an exclusive in-game weapon – the formidable automatic shotgun – and four art cards by the Russian painter Anton Grechko, who was commissioned to create a range of artwork inspired by the universe of Metro 2033.

Turn any keyboard & mouse into an FPS advantage on your PS3!

Converts Keyboard and Mouse into Turbo Controller for First-Person Shooter Video Games

Fremont, Calif., (December, 2009) – Ask most video game fanatics and they’ll tell you that first-person shooters just play better using a keyboard and mouse. That’s why Penguin United has created the Eagle-Eye Converter in order to meet this specific need. The Eagle-Eye is an adapter that converts any standard USB HID keyboard and mouse into a turbo charged controller for the Sony PS3 video game console. The Eagle-Eye Converter will be on display at CES January 7-10, at Booth #5413, North Hall.
